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ration in Sun City Phase 36

  • Visible water stains on wallsWater stains indicate that there is moisture accumulation behind the walls, which can lead to mold growth if not addressed quickly.
  • Musty odors in your homeA musty smell often suggests mold growth or dampness, which requires immediate professional attention to prevent health risks.
  • Peeling paint or wallpaperThis can signify water damage behind the surfaces, indicating the need for inspection and potential restoration services.
  • Increased utility billsIf you notice a sudden spike in your water bill, it may suggest a leak or water damage issue that needs to be investigated.
  • Swollen or warped flooringFlooring damage often indicates prolonged exposure to moisture, necessitating urgent restoration to avoid further structural issues.

What is the process for Water Damage Restoration in Sun City Phase 36?

The process typically involves assessing the damage, extracting water, drying the area, and repairing any affected structures.

How long does Water Damage Restoration take?

Most jobs take 2 to 4 days, depending on the extent of the damage and drying requirements.

What are the signs of water damage in my home?

Signs include water stains, musty odors, and warped flooring. If you notice these, contact us immediately.

Is mold a concern after water damage?

Yes, mold can develop within 24-48 hours after water exposure. Prompt restoration is essential to prevent it.
